Seven charitable organizations are bequeathed $605,000 by the estate of the late Mrs. Therese Schiff, widow of Jacob H. Schiff, banker and philanthropist. Mrs. Schiff died last February at the age of seventy-eight.
Included in the bequests are $250,000 to the Federation for the Support of Jewish Philanthropic Societies; $150,000 to the Jewish Theologicla Seminary Library; $125,000 to the Solomon and Betty Loeb Memorial House for Convalescents and $50,000 to the Henry Street Settlement; Tuskegee Normal and Industrial Institution of Alabama, the Auxiliary of the Montefiore Home and the Y.W.H.A. of New York City, $10,000 each.
The remainder of the estate went to members of the family.
